If a right circular cone is intersected by a plane only at its vertex, as in the picture below, what shape is produced?

A right circular cone can be intersected by some plane to produce circle, ellipse, hyperbola depending upon where the plane is crossing the cone.

But if the plane crosses at the vertex. Just one point is crossed.

Hence resulting shape will be a "point".
